Job Duties Under general supervision, responsible for professionally installing cable in field site hole and spool the cable as it is pulled from the hole. Load, perform pre-trip inspection, transport cable spool from the shop to the field site location and rig up. Band cable to the tubing as the cable is run into the hole, splice or pack off cable and handle pulls of cable to the spool. Responsible for unloading cable at the shop and reloading for next trip. Prepare paperwork to include DOT requirements, IFTA reports, billable and non-billable hours and mileage. Job tasks, correctly performed, impact indirectly on cost containment, efficiency, profitability or operations. Maintain mechanical performance of truck used in transportation to and from the field. Train and mentor lower level technicians at the well site. Skills are typically acquired through successful completion of high school or similar education and 3 to 4 years of experience.
